We treated the tongue tieâso why is your child still snoring, grinding, and waking up tired?
Because releasing the tie is only half the story. đ§ľ
Crowded teeth arenât a âtheyâll grow into itâ problem. Teeth crowd because the jaw is too small to hold themâand a jaw thatâs too small usually means a palate thatâs too narrow.
Hereâs what most people miss: the roof of the mouth is also the floor of the nose. Every millimeter the upper arch is too narrow is a millimeter the nasal airway is too tight. So breathing works harderâday and night.
At night, that shows up as:
â Snoring in a small child
â Grinding teeth
â Tossing, sweating, waking
â Never feeling truly rested
Sleep is when kids grow, heal, and regulate. A crowded airway quietly steals from all of it.
This is why âspaceâ isnât cosmetic. Itâs how a child breathes, sleeps, and grows into their full potential. Straightening teeth later doesnât change the size of the foundationâthe space has to come first.
A narrow palate isnât just a dental problem. Itâs an airway problem wearing a dental disguise.

Your babyâs tongue tie was never just about feeding. đ§ľ
It was the first clue.
Hereâs what most parents are never told: the tongue is a natural expander. When it can rest high against the roof of the mouth, it shapes the palate wide and open â the way itâs supposed to grow.
When it canât, the palate grows narrow and high. And because the roof of the mouth is also the floor of the nose, that narrow shape leaves less room for air. So the body adapts the only way it can â it breathes through the mouth.
Thatâs when parents start noticing things theyâd never connect to a tie:â¨đ A mouth thatâs always openâ¨đ´ Restless, noisy sleepâ¨đ Dark circles and âallergy faceââ¨đڎ Crowded baby teeth
Different symptoms. Same root cause â not enough room in a face that was built to have more.
The tie was the first clue. The shape of the mouth is where the real story unfolds.
